Need to change my caste from Schedule Caste to Maratha
20-Sep-2023 (In Family Law)
Hi All, I want to marry a girl who is from Maratha caste and I am from SC caste Religion Hindu. I dont follow or like this caste system at all. But for the girl whom i am going to marry is the best girl that i can have in my life. Her mother is ready for me but her father is stick to caste only. I spoke with her Father and he said if you can change your caste for her and Maratha then only I can give you my girl else forget . So I need your expert advice to change the caste from SC to Maratha. I want to change my caste by Hook or Crook just for that girl I love the most. Please please help me with this. Your advice can make Ones life.
Dear Client,
You cannot change your caste. Your caste is determined by your birth. By default your father's caste is your caste. If your parents belong to different castes then, on special circumstances, you have an option to choose between either one of their castes.
Only way the caste of person gets changed , is when you gets adopted by a person of different caste. e.g. A Brahmin can become an SC/ST, if adopted by an SC/ST person and vice-versa.

You can choose to be a Hindu or any other religion but you cannot change your caste. Your caste is determined by your birth. If your parents belong to different castes then you can change any one from it. If you and the girl are adults then no one can stop you from marrying eachother on the basis of caste.
There is a Supreme Court judgement that person born under a caste will remain in the same caste irrespective of him changing his religion or faith. Your case is challenging and you need to make your in law understand this.
